Home | History | Annotate | Download | only in CodeGen

Lines Matching defs:Def

121   int Def;
365 LiveRegs[rx].Def = -(1 << 20);
378 LiveRegs[rx].Def = -1;
395 // Use the most recent predecessor def for each register.
396 LiveRegs[rx].Def = std::max(LiveRegs[rx].Def, fi->second[rx].Def);
436 LiveRegs[i].Def -= CurInstr;
465 /// \brief Return true to if it makes sense to break dependence on a partial def
473 unsigned Clearance = CurInstr - LiveRegs[rx].Def;
480 // The current clearance seems OK, but we may be ignoring a def from a
486 // A def from an unprocessed back-edge may make us break this dependency.
491 // Update def-ages for registers defined by MI.
525 // Call breakDependence before setting LiveRegs[rx].Def.
531 LiveRegs[rx].Def = CurInstr;
657 if (LR.Def < i->Def) {
699 // all the operators, including imp-def ones.